How to Finance Pest Treatment You Can’t Pay Upfront

Pest treatment costs, particularly for termites, can be a real budget consideration — several financing paths can help.

Contractor Financing

Many pest control companies, particularly those handling larger termite treatment jobs, offer in-house payment plans or partner financing — ask specifically when getting quotes.

How to apply without damaging your options

Applications for contractor-arranged financing typically run through a lender partner and involve a credit check. If you are collecting several quotes, ask each provider whether their prequalification is a soft inquiry before you agree to it, since multiple hard inquiries in quick succession can affect your score at the moment you least want that. Many lenders offer a soft prequalification that returns an indicative rate without a hard pull.

Have the basics ready so the process does not stall the treatment: proof of income, identification, and the written quote itself, since the approved amount is usually tied to the scope of work on the estimate. If the scope changes after approval, for example because the inspection found more activity, the financing may need to be revised rather than simply topped up.

General Home Improvement Financing

A personal loan, HELOC, or promotional 0%-APR credit card are general-purpose alternatives applicable to pest treatment the same as any home improvement expense.

Matching the borrowing term to the treatment, not the maximum offered

Lenders generally quote the longest term you qualify for, because it produces the most attractive monthly payment. That is rarely the cheapest choice. A useful discipline is to pick the shortest term whose payment you can comfortably sustain, then check the total repayable against the shorter alternatives before committing.

  • Run the total repayable at each term offered, not only the monthly payment.
  • Check for prepayment penalties if you expect to clear it early.
  • Confirm whether the rate is fixed or variable, particularly on a line of credit.
  • Keep the borrowing separate from any funds already earmarked for repairs.

Where termite damage is involved, remember the treatment and the structural repair are two separate bills arriving at different times. Borrowing the full amount for treatment and leaving nothing for carpentry is a common sequencing mistake.

Real Estate Transaction Negotiation

If pest issues were discovered during a home purchase via a WDO inspection, negotiating seller-funded treatment or a price credit is a well-established real estate practice.

Documenting what was agreed

Whatever form the negotiation takes, the agreement needs to be written into the contract or an addendum rather than left as an understanding between agents. The useful terms are specific: which company performs the work, what method, by what date, who receives the warranty, and what happens if the treatment reveals additional activity once work begins.

If a credit is given instead of completed work, confirm whether your lender permits seller credits at that amount, since some loan programs cap them. And if the property is being sold as-is, a credit may be the only realistic route, which makes getting an accurate quote before contingencies expire more important rather than less.
